"A Place To Stand" by maddin foxxxy

I find you in the place i left,
the place of no return
where you were kept
and your fire always burn.
The place i do recall,
your face is blurry as hell
where i had thrown my all
in a hole in which i fell.
Can you find yourself in here?
Could you differ from the rest?
My shoulders still carry your fears...
My will still believes i did my best.
Your name is no one
Your existance is fading fast
Somehow an ending has begun
since such a distant past.
I wish to wish nothing
except to have wind in between my hands,
and for you to someday bring
a place where i can stand.
